About Emma Cacciola

Emma Cacciola is a scholar working on Hematology, Genetics,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Molecular Biology, having authored 42 papers that have together received 521 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(9 papers), Myeloproliferative Neoplasms: Diagnosis and Treatment (8 papers), Abdominal Trauma and Injuries (7 papers), Platelet Disorders and Treatments (7 papers), Kruppel-like factors research (6 papers),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(6 papers), Appendicitis Diagnosis and Management (5 papers) and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(211 citations), Hematology (214 citations), Internal Medicine (16 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(75 citations) and Emergency Medicine (35 citations). Emma Cacciola has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Rosario Giustolisi, Rossella Cacciola, Rosario Vecchio, Patrizia Guglielmo, Michael J. Keating, Francesco Di Raimondo, Grazia Sortino, Hagop M. Kantarjian, Susan O’Brien and Fabio Stagno. Their work appears in journals such as Acta Haematologica, Journal of Laparoendoscopic & Advanced Surgical Techniques, Updates in Surgery, British Journal of Haematology and Thrombosis and Haemostasis.
